I just picked up a 1986 Johnson 9.9, when I was picking it up I ran it and it shifted gears. Now that I got it back to the house I tried to shift gears while the motor was not running and it wont go into forward just reverse. Is this normal because the engine is not running, like some kind of safety to make sure its in neutral ?

Re: 1986 Johnson 9.9 Shift Problem

Sounds like the gears won't mesh. Try turning the prop by hand a bit while trying to shift.

If they do I don't think there is a problem.

Re: 1986 Johnson 9.9 Shift Problem

The cluthch dogs will not engage UNLESS aligned. SO as you have noticed, unless the prop shaft is aligned with the driveshaft the gears will not engage (the transmission is in the lower unit gearbox) . If you have to shift without it running, pulling the rope starter a tad while applying pressure on the shifting lever, can move the driveshaft just enough to allow these dogs to engage. As said, while running it is no problem then,
